Textures to Belief (and These to Keep away from)

Go For Skip
Cream-based masks that say “therapeutic massage in or tissue off” Clay-based formulation that tighten as they dry
Gel masks with out menthol or “cooling” brokers Peel-off masks (too stripping, too 2006)
Bio-cellulose or hydrogel sheet masks Powder masks it’s important to combine your self (an excessive amount of work for careworn pores and skin)

Finest strategy: Summer season pores and skin wants consolation and calm, not tightening or stimulation. Suppose blanket, not Band-Help.

Substances—Sure, Please vs. Please No

Substances to Love Substances to Keep away from (Proper Now)
Glycerin, Hyaluronic Acid, Linoleic Acid AHAs, BHAs, and resurfacing acids of any type
Squalane, Ceramides, Panthenol Scrubbing particles (shells, pits, volcanic ash, and many others.)
Aloe Vera, Chamomile, Centella Asiatica (Cica) Menthol, peppermint, eucalyptus, “stimulating” oils
Jojoba Oil, Shea Butter, Vitamin E Closely fragranced important oils (particularly on already-reactive pores and skin)

Word: The one “acids” welcome listed below are the hydrating type—no resurfacing, no tingling. We’re going for the alternative of peeling.

Paula’s Selection Hydrating Remedy Masks

No one does sensible fairly like Paula’s Selection, and this masks is textbook PC: environment friendly, unfussy, and really well-formulated. It’s a nutrient-rich mix of barrier-repairing plant oils—borage, apricot kernel, night primrose, olive, macadamia—that work quick to revive calm. I wouldn’t sleep in it (it leans wealthy), however as a 20-minute reset, it’s close to good. Perfume-free, pleasantly primary, and precisely what you need round when your pores and skin doesn’t want a pep discuss, only a plan.

Activist Mānuka Honey Masks 850+ MGO

It doesn’t get extra single-ingredient than this: pure, uncooked mānuka honey—and never the stuff drizzled in your oatmeal. That is high-grade, high-MGO (850+) honey that soothes, heals, and calms with virtually unnerving pace when your pores and skin is indignant, infected, or simply plain over it. [Quick MGO lesson: MGO stands for Methylglyoxal, the compound primarily responsible for Manuka honey’s antibacterial properties; this is considered a very high concentration—typically used for therapeutic purposes (wound healing, topical treatments, or short-term immune support).] There’s nothing to decode and nowhere to cover. Skip the fridge (chilly honey will get grainy) and use a light-weight hand—it spreads simply, and also you don’t want a lot to really feel the shift. It’s a little bit of a ritual, however one which works. And sure, it’s nice in the event you lick your fingers afterward.
